Ke koho ʻana i ka Crucible kūpono no kāu kaʻina hana hoʻolei metala

Hāʻawi ʻia kā mākou crucibles i ʻelua ʻano kumu: graphite clay crucibles a me silicon carbide graphite crucibles. Eia pehea e koho ai i ka ipu hao kūpono no kāu kaʻina hoʻoheheʻe metala:

  1. ʻO Graphite Clay Crucibles: He kūpono no nā noi haʻahaʻa haʻahaʻa e like me ka hoʻolei keleawe a i ʻole nā ​​metala makamae. Hāʻawi kēia mau crucibles i ka mālama wela maikaʻi loa a he kumukūʻai.
  2. ʻO Silicon Carbide Graphite Crucibles: ʻOi loa no ka hoʻolei ʻana i ka wela kiʻekiʻe, ʻoi aku hoʻi no nā metala non-ferrous e like me ka alumini. Me ka hoʻololi ʻana i ka wela wikiwiki, hāʻawi kēia mau crucibles i hoʻonui i ka pale ʻana i ka haʻalulu wela a me ke kūpaʻa corrosion, e hoʻolilo iā lākou i mea kūpono no nā noi koi ʻoi aku.

 Q4: Pehea e pale ai i ka crucible cracking?

Mai hoʻouka i ka mea anuanu i loko o kahi kīʻaha wela (max ΔT <400°C).

Ka helu hoʻoluʻu ma hope o ka hoʻoheheʻe ʻana <200°C / hola.

E hoʻohana i nā ʻōpala crucible i hoʻolaʻa ʻia (e pale i ka hopena mechanical).
